Extension Calling: advice for the farm, garden, and home

Jul 31, 2022

Deer, love 'em or hate 'em, they're everywhere. While, feeding the deer can make them sick, losing your crop to them can make you sick.  There are many ways to manage this prevalent pest. Tune in to find out which one's work and which don't.